Irrespective of whether you are constructing your new home or are simply looking for a lock replacement you must consider these three options. Here is everything you need to know about them:

  1. Mortise Locks – Mortise locks are those which require a rectangular hole to be drilled on the wall for their installation. They are generally considered as an older locking mechanism, however even then they are widely popular amongst emergency locksmiths in Sherwood Park. A mortise lock will keep the bolt inserted inside the hole whenever it is locked. Today, they come with myriad styles of knobs which range from round to bar type eventually making it a popular choice amongst homeowners.
  2. Deadbolt Locks – Deadbolts are basically a modified version of mortise locks and can be regarded as a better way of locking down your property. The difference between them and regular door locks is that deadbolts will require a key access for both the inside and outside of their house. These locks thus work as a secondary option for all those homeowners who prefer adding an additional security feature for the front doors of their home. Emergency locksmiths in Sherwood Park though sometimes advise not to buy some typical forms of deadbolts since they can make escape difficult from the house in case of an emergency.
  3. Keyless Locks – Keyless lock systems are the newest in the addition and have increasingly become popular within homeowners because of the various advancements security that it offers. Keyless locks basically make use of fingerprint, security code or eye-scanning techniques for locking/unlocking the door. These locks, therefore, don’t make use of key on a daily basis and uses them only as a back-up option in case the lock’s electronic capability ruptures. Locksmiths in Sherwood Park have installed hundreds of such keyless locks in homes that also include an alarm mechanism if a wrong code is entered.
